Clapham stabbing: Six men arrested over murder of 22-year-old man | UK News

Six men have been arrested on suspicion of murder after a 22-year-old man was fatally stabbed in Clapham, south-west London, the Metropolitan Police has said.

Police were called at 04:37 BST following reports of a man attending hospital with a stab wound. He later died in hospital, the force said.

The incident is believed to have taken place around Tremadoc Road and Clapham High Street.

Police said four of the suspects also attended hospital with stab wounds and are continuing to receive treatment, although their injuries are not believed to be life-threatening or life-changing.

Alongside the four men in hospital – three aged 22 and one 24 – officers also arrested two further men, aged 27 and 23, at the hospital on suspicion of murder. They remain in police custody.

The Met said it understood the fatally injured man was stabbed at about 04:20. It added that officers were carrying out inquiries in and around Tremadoc Road and Clapham High Street to establish the full circumstances around the incident.

Det Ch Insp Sarah Lee, who is leading the investigation, said those in the area would continue to notice an increased police presence throughout Saturday.

The family of the man who died have been informed and are being supported by specialist officers.

Supt Mark Gallacher, a policing lead for the area, described the incident as “tragic”.

“We understand that this will cause concern among the local community and specialist detectives are doing everything possible to determine what has happened,” he added.

The Met urged witnesses or people with information about the incident to contact police on 101, quoting reference 1474/25July.

Information can also be provided anonymously to independent charity Crimestoppers on 0800 555 111.
